Can you use hay for dog bedding?

Do NOT use hay (OR blankets) for bedding in outdoor shelters. Hay is green and heavy. Hay is typically used to feed animals, like horses. It absorbs moisture, making it damp, cold and uncomfortable for animals, and has the potential to get moldy. Many dogs prefer to spend the majority of their time outdoors, especially … Read more

Can you vacuum fleas off a dog?

Finally, a study shows vacuuming is indeed an effective weapon. Experiments conducted by Ohio State University researchers on the cat flea (Ctenocephalides felis)—the most common type of flea plaguing companion animals, such as dogs and cats, and humans—showed that vacuuming killed fleas in all stages of life. Can you use a pregnancy test on a dog?

Yes. The blood test detects pregnancy in the the pregnant dog by measuring levels of a hormone called relaxin. This hormone is produced by the developing placenta following implantation of the embryo, and can be detected in the blood in most pregnant females as early as 22-27 days post-breeding.
